Dec 5, 2021 · Dole ran three times for president. He lost in primaries in 1980 to Ronald Reagan and in 1988 to George H.W. Bush. He won the Republican party nomination in 1996, but lost the general election to ... Carter's running mate, said. Dole went back to the Senate and resumed his political career, but when he ... Vice Presidential. Ford selected Kansas Senator Robert J. Dole as his running mate, as unelected incumbent Vice President Rockefeller had announced the previous fall that he would not be a candidate for a full term in 1976.. After Ronald Reagan lost the presidential ballot to incumbent Gerald Ford, 103 of his delegates walked out of the convention, and …

In 1976, President Gerald Ford selected Dole to be his running mate in his campaign for the presidency against Democrats Jimmy Carter and Walter Mondale. However, Carter and Mondale won the election.
